Re: [PATCH v1 8/9] ntfs: only count successfully cleared runs when freeing clusters

> ntfs_cluster_free_from_rl_nolock() adds a run's length to nr_freed
> whenever the error bookkeeping condition is false, which includes
> cases where ntfs_bitmap_clear_run() actually failed - e.g. a second
> run failing with the same errno as an earlier one, or any failure
> after a non-ENOMEM error was already recorded. Since a failed
> ntfs_bitmap_clear_run() rolls back its partial modifications, no
> bits were cleared for that run, yet its length still inflates
> vol->free_clusters, corrupting statfs output and the allocator's
> free space gate.
>
> Only count runs whose bitmap clear succeeded.

> diff --git a/fs/ntfs/lcnalloc.c b/fs/ntfs/lcnalloc.c
> index aa2e017a4384..795f71d26895 100644
> --- a/fs/ntfs/lcnalloc.c
> +++ b/fs/ntfs/lcnalloc.c
> @@ -53,10 +53,10 @@ int ntfs_cluster_free_from_rl_nolock(struct ntfs_volume *vol,
> if (rl->lcn < 0)
> continue;
> err = ntfs_bitmap_clear_run(lcnbmp_vi, rl->lcn, rl->length);
> - if (unlikely(err && (!ret || ret == -ENOMEM) && ret != err))
> - ret = err;
> - else
> + if (likely(!err))
> nr_freed += rl->length;
> + else if (!ret || ret == -ENOMEM)
> + ret = err;
> }
> ntfs_inc_free_clusters(vol, nr_freed);
> ntfs_debug("Done.");
